The atomic weight of hydrogen (not mass) is [1,007 84; 1,008 11]; the conventional value is 1,008.
for most scientofic purposes it is 1 amu (atomic mass unit). This comes from 1 proton and zero neutrons. The average atomic mass is 1.00794 amu.
